Charges are pending for a man after he allegedly fled border authorities at the Ambassador Bridge.
Windsor police say he was arrested without incident at the Husky on County Rd. 46 by city officers, assisted by the OPP. Windsor police say the vehicle driven by the suspect was reported stolen in the U.S.
Initial reports suggested the man may be armed, but police haven't said if a weapon was recovered.
At one point, police say the suspect was last seen at the old Greyhound bus depot in downtown Windsor. "We know that he fled the customs border point and he abandoned his vehicle in the area of Huron Church and Girardot," says Windsor police Staff Sergeant Matthew D'Asti.
Schools in the area were under a hold and secure, but that has since been lifted at all public and Catholic schools.
